Certified Primary Stroke Center

 

Stroke is the nation’s third leading cause of death. Those who survive a stroke are subject to more serious long-term disabilities than with any other disease. In all, stroke affects about 700,000 Americans each year. It can happen at any age, though nearly three-quarters of all strokes occur in people over the age of 65. The risk of having a stroke more than doubles with each decade after age 55.

St.Vincent was the first Central Indiana hospital accredited as a primary stroke center, and we offer our patients an unparalleled stroke program that includes:

  • Emergency interventions
  • Surgical and non-surgical treatments
  • Extensive rehabilitation services
  • Skilled Rapid Response Team, including trained emergency department personnel
  • Aggressive treatment using the most advanced clot-dissolving drugs and clot-removing procedures
  • Neurology and neurosurgery coverage 24/7
  • Neuroscience nurses specializing in the care of stroke patients
  • Acute stroke unit with an integrated rehabilitation department
